Cabled: Most people use a cabled connection directly to the router and if this is possible for you to do is the best way to connect.

HomePlugs: Home plugs / power line adapters work very well where the above is not an option. For £20 you get a connection nearly, if not as good, as the above.

Wireless: Wireless adapters, some people have success with these others don't. The location of the box, the quality of the adapter, the luck you have all play a factor. I bought one just to play with and it reboots my box once and then starts to work. It does this every time I boot. Others, BeakyFord for example has had sucess with one for a setup he did.
